What is Auto Reclosing?

Auto reclosing is a phenomenon in which the breaker tries to reconnect the line between two points with the delay or without delay at the time of the fault. Auto recloser is a device which can open at the time of fault and reclose after a

energy storage time and reclosing of circuit breakers

Novel adaptive reclosing scheme using wavelet transform in distribution system with battery energy storage In the conventional reclosing scheme, the BESS is disconnected from distribution system and reclosing is performed after fixed dead times of 0.5 s and 15 s. INTRODUCTION TO PRESSURE RELIEF DEVICES

Non-reclosing pressure relief devices are of two types: rupture disks and pin devices. Rupture Disks A rupture disk is designed to rupture at a predetermined pressure and temperature.
